Frequently Asked Questions about Manhattan
What type of rentals are currently available in Manhattan?
There are currently 40937 Apartments for Rent in Manhattan, NY with pricing that ranges from $1,050 to $100,000. There are also 2845 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Manhattan ranging from $1,500 to $61,500.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Manhattan?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Manhattan ranges from $1,500 to $61,500 with an average monthly rent of $10,183.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Manhattan?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Manhattan range from $1,050 to $100,000,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$2,200 to $45,000.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$3,400 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$1,125.
